CV6 1BZ is a safe, established residential area on Lavender Avenue, 0.9km from Coundon in Coventry. Administratively it sits within Sherbourne ward and the Coventry North West constituency.
This is a strong family neighbourhood — a classic working-class terrace area — densely packed streets, low ethnic diversity. The daytime character shifts — ethnically mixed self-employed professional services, home workers in outer suburbs. The 38 average age reflects a mixed, mid-career community — settling down but not yet slowing down. 80%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 19 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£203k.
Census 2021 statistics for CV6 1BZ are sourced from Output Area E00048855 (shared with 7 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
